Tower Records to launch TowerPod

Tower Records of Sacramento, Calif., is about to enter the digital download arena -- but unlike Apple's iTunes, the service will be free.

TowerPod, which will be formally announced during the South By Southwest music festival in Austin, Texas, later this month, will offer a free library of 6,000 songs from independent artists and labels for podcast downloads, FMQB.com reported Tuesday.

Revenue will come from embedded ads and will be split between the labels, artists and podcast creators.

The Web site, www.towerpod.com, will be in addition to the music store's existing Tower Connection site, which is linked to the retail sales site.

The retail chain is for sale two years after emerging from bankruptcy protection and is being marketed by the Los Angeles investment banking firm of Houlihan Lokey Howard & Zukin.
